SWTC named Number 1 two-year college in the nation
Southwest Tech has received the 2025 Aspen Prize for Community College Excellence, the highest award a community college can earn.
FENNIMORE, Wis (WRCO / WRCE) – Southwest Wisconsin Technical College is celebrating a major honor — being named the #1 two-year college in the nation.

A free, family-friendly celebration is planned for Saturday, September 27 from 10 a.m. to 3 p.m. on the main campus in Fennimore. No registration is needed, and everyone is welcome.
The day will feature hands-on demonstrations from academic programs, campus tours, giveaways, food trucks, and live music.
The Aspen Prize is awarded every two years to one college in the country for outstanding student learning, completion rates, equity, and post-college success.
